Output 73df9640ecf45449958fa2983a01aa6e3618a0b926463d829d7d9e83924903ba:3

value
3697567429
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1ef6564bd9cf3faf13398a5ffdc229463e4147d8 OP_EQUAL
address
MAisbzAtLtFLjc3k6iPPJNmjb84wHjYHM6
transaction
73df9640ecf45449958fa2983a01aa6e3618a0b926463d829d7d9e83924903ba
spent
true